Hi @HugoFernandoMirandaMorin-0312,
Firstly, If you have used “Azure Monitor agent” that is explained here then I would recommend you to use Azure Monitor Log Analytics agent as instructed here. The reason for it is “Azure Monitor Agent” still in preview and would be Generally Available by Jan/Feb 2021 and as informed in this section, currently only Azure VMs are supported and on-premises VMs, virtual machine scale sets, Arc for Servers, Azure Kubernetes Service, and other compute resource types are currently not supported.
Next, If you have “Azure Monitor Log Analytics agent on Windows machine” then you may have to check below things:
1. As explained here, Change Tracking and Inventory requires linking a Log Analytics workspace to your Automation account so I recommend you to double check it. For a definitive list of supported regions, see Azure Workspace mappings. The region mappings don't affect the ability to manage VMs in a separate region from your Automation account.
2. Follow this troubleshooting steps in your case (i.e., if you don't see any Change Tracking and Inventory results for Windows machines that have been enabled for the feature).
3. As mentioned here, note that currently Change Tracking and Inventory currently is experiencing the following issue w.r.t Windows environment: Hotfix updates aren't collected on Windows Server 2016 Core RS3 machines.

I appreciate the information shared, I have verified the points you share with me, I have a question, you mention that Azure Monitor is only enabled for VM on Azure and Physical Servers, If I try to use the solution in VM in a Data Center, viewed with Hyper -v is this possible?
Hi @hmiranda79, I believe yes because in general we should be able to install the MMA agent on Hyper-V server or windows computer (and if the environment is without internet access then connect it to log analytics using OMS gateway) and configure log analytics to collect required windows performance logs.
